Paint/masking tape storage
Whenever I go to paint a body I'm always scratching around trying to find whether I have the right paint or masking tape or sharp scalpel blade etc. - it drives me mad! So I finally decided to do something about it and after looking at lots of storage containers I came up with the idea that I would build one myself which held everything I needed in one place and this is the result. I purchased a sheet of 9mm ply and got most of the cuts done by my local DIY store with their nice timber saw - that gives a you a really good start to getting everything square etc. The backing is 6mm ply, rebated into the sides for strength then the whole thing has had a coat of wax to seal it. Quite pleased with the result and it has freed up another drawer in a storage unit for other spares :)
